Lowering thick plants is a critical aspect of landscape management, helping to restore order, improve looks, and promote plant health. Overgrowth can restrict airflow, decrease sunshine penetration, and create chances for bugs and illness. Pruning and thinning are the main techniques for handling dense or unruly plants, enabling plants to flourish while maintaining a controlled appearance. The process includes selectively eliminating excess branches, stems, and foliage, constantly considering the natural development practice of each species. Timing is necessary; some plants react best to pruning during inactivity, while blooming varieties may require post-bloom trimming to protect blossoms. Proper technique ensures cuts are tidy and positioned to motivate healthy new growth. In addition to boosting plant health, lowering overgrowth enhances ease of access and presence in the landscape Paths, driveways, and outside home end up being much safer and more inviting. Long-lasting upkeep strategies prevent future overgrowth, ensuring a balanced and unified landscape.
